Reiki History: Tracing the Origins of Energy Healing

The history of reiki go back to the early 20th century in Japan. It was established by Mikao Usui, a Japanese Buddhist monk who looked for to comprehend the ancient healing practices of his ancestors. Usui went through a spiritual awakening on Mount Kurama, where he acquired the understanding and ability to channel healing energy.

Since then, reiki has spread out throughout the world, progressing into various lineages and variations. Today, it is recognized as a respectable form of energy healing that promotes holistic wellness.

Reiki Level 1: Initiating the Journey

Reiki training typically includes several levels of attunement, with each level offering professionals with brand-new understanding and capabilities. Reiki Level 1, likewise known as the "First Degree," is the initiation into the practice of energy healing.

During this level of training, students discover the fundamental hand positions, signs, and strategies required to perform reiki on themselves and others. It is a fundamental level that sets the phase for additional expedition and growth on the planet of energy work.

Reiki Level 2: Deepening the Connection

Reiki Level 2, likewise referred to as the "Second Degree," builds upon the foundation established in Level 1. At this phase, professionals discover additional signs and techniques to boost their ability to channel and control energy.

One of the crucial elements of Level 2 training is the focus on distance healing. Professionals are taught how to send reiki energy throughout time and area, allowing them to supply recovery support to individuals who are not physically present.
